Available Support
Many individuals find comfort in listening to and learning from their peers. Support is especially helpful when grieving the death of a loved one. Throughout each year VNA & Hospice offers grief support groups. Groups are divided into three age categories; adults, teens and children. Groups are open to the entire community, and do not discriminate toward any type of loss. Each group takes place over six to eight consecutive weeks and is closed to new participants upon the initial start date and is facilitated by a VNA & Hospice staff member.
Adult groups are offered four times a year. Our work together will provide participants with the support needed and freedom from the isolation a loss can bring.
Teen groups are available twice a year. The use of art and photography are incorporated into the group as a concrete and creative method of expressing grief through healing.
Our kids group is also offered at least twice a year. Children ages 5-12 are encouraged to play and create art while applying the basic principles of grief and exploration of feelings associated with morning.
